God's Own Country

Josh O’Connor (Challengers, The Crown) stars as Johnny Saxby, an English farmer numbing the pain of his lonely existence with nightly binge-drinking at the local pub and casual sex. When a handsome Romanian migrant worker arrives to take up temporary work on the family farm, Johnny suddenly finds himself having to deal with emotions he has never felt before. An intense relationship forms between the two which could change Johnny’s life forever. Winner of the World Cinema Directing Award at Sundance, this debut from Francis Lee explores the quiet ache of isolation—and the transformative power of unexpected connection.

"In his debut feature, Lee has crafted a mature love story centered on an immature man facing the fear of even admitting that he needs love at all. It's a film to prize".
Alan Scherstuhl, Village Voice
